摘要: 褪黑素是由松果体分泌的一种吲哚胺,在各种生理活动中起着关键作用,包括调节昼夜节律、免疫应答、氧化过程及细胞凋亡。近年来,褪黑素的抗肿瘤特性逐渐引起关注。大量研究发现,褪黑素在急性胰腺炎早期过程中起保护作用,可通过细胞凋亡途径抑制胰腺癌细胞的产生,且可通过自噬作用调节胰腺内分泌激素的合成分泌从而影响胰腺内分泌肿瘤的发展。由此,褪黑素可能影响胰腺疾病的发展,但其对胰腺疾病的作用机理尚未完全明确。本文综述了近几年褪黑素与胰腺疾病的研究进展,分析了褪黑素在胰腺疾病中的作用,以及褪黑素联合化疗药物对胰腺癌的治疗作用。

Abstract: Melatonin is an indoleamine secreted by the pineal gland and plays a key role in a variety of physiological activities, including the regulation of circadian rhythm, immune response, oxidative process and apoptosis. In recent years, the anti-tumor properties of melatonin have attracted more and more attention. A large number of studies have found that melatonin plays a protective role in the early process of acute pancreatitis and can inhibit the production of pancreatic adenocarcinoma cells through apoptosis; moreover, it can regulate the synthesis and secretion of pancreatic endocrine hormones through autophagy and affect the development of pancreatic endocrine tumors. Therefore, melatonin may affect the development of pancreatic disease, but the mechanism of its action on pancreatic diseases has not been fully understood. This paper reviews the research progress of melatonin and pancreatic diseases in recent years, analyzes the role of melatonin in pancreatic diseases and the therapeutic effect of melatonin combined with chemotherapy drugs on pancreatic cancer.
